随着经济的快速发展,经济技术的进步,机组的容量越来越大,效率与参数也不断的提高,火力发电机组中的主流机组已经变成了,600MW与1000MW级的机组。在进行锅炉安装的过程中,关于“四管”的防爆一直是电力企业发展中高度重视的一个问题,尤其是近几年来,锅炉的温度与压力在不断的提升,因而电力企业在“四管”防爆问题上面临的挑战也日益严峻。从锅炉的生产制造到安装运行,包含了多个环节,其爆炸的原因也是千差万别的。笔者在此结合某公司的案例对锅炉安装作业中的“四管”防爆措施进行阐述分析。
